Research & Clinical Interest
My major research interests are the pathogenesis of rabies, the immune mechanisms involved in virus clearance from the central nervous system (CNS), and the development of novel vaccines and immune therapeutics for pre- and post-exposure prophylaxis of rabies and other virus infections of the CNS.
